翻譯|使用教程|編輯:楊鵬連|2020-09-23 11:56:00.840|閱讀 259 次
概述:PL/SQL Developer是一個集成開發環境,它專門針對Oracle數據庫的存儲程序單元的開發所用。本文主要介紹PL/SQL Developer產品有什么功能。
# 界面/圖表報表/文檔/IDE等千款熱門軟控件火熱銷售中 >>
PL/SQL Developer是一個集成開發環境,它專門針對Oracle數據庫的存儲程序單元的開發所用。現在越來越多的商業邏輯和應用程式邏輯都在使用Oracle服務器,所以PL/SQL編程在整個開發過程中也變得越來越重要。PL/SQL Developer在開發Oracle應用程序的時候都注重于開發工具簡單易用,代碼簡潔和開發效率高等特點。PL/SQL Developer不僅很好的提供了上述的特點,而且還具有很多其他的優勢。
PL/SQL Developer已加入 在線訂購,(Annual Service Contract )Single user版本原價600元,現在活動價只需490元,點擊查看授權方式和其他版本優惠
系統要求
您可以在此處下載該軟件。PL / SQL Developer試用版具有全部功能,并具有您在注冊版中可以找到的所有功能,僅受30天試用期限制。
安裝耗時約20秒。它按我預期的方式工作。安裝程序檢測到我的桌面上有多個Oracle主目錄的事實,并告訴我如果我不喜歡它所做的選擇,則可以在首選項中更改它。確保已安裝并正確配置了Oracle的網絡軟件(SQL * Net及更高版本)。
它能做什么
Allround的崇高目標是允許開發人員在PSD中執行所有日常Oracle編程任務。與我已經審查過的具有相同目標的其他工具不同,我很高興地報告Allround成功。自1997年6月以來,我一直在評估新的和升級的PL / SQL IDE,這是我第一次真正發現自己將所有時間都花在一個工具上。有人捏我 我死了去天堂了嗎?!
需要采取的行動
我發現的最獨特的功能是,在可以找到或引用該對象的任何地方都可以使用某個對象允許的操作。Allround必須在內部擁有可用性專家。
PSD不會通過將某些操作隔離到某些窗口來跟隨包的其余部分。例如,在PSD中,一張桌子可以做很多事情。其中包括獲取表的屬性,描述表和查詢表。當然,當您右鍵單擊瀏覽器窗格中的表時,將顯示這些操作,但這是大多數PL / SQL IDE停止的地方。在PSD中,無論該表名顯示在什么地方,右鍵單擊該名稱都會給您相同的選項。表格名稱是否在解釋計劃的結果,命令窗口查詢的輸出,在列注釋內,作為變量的%TYPE聲明的一部分,還是在空白編輯器中的隨機文本都沒有關系。如果您當前的連接可以以所有者身份或通過同義詞看到該表,它會將文本識別為Oracle對象,并為您提供對該對象,所需時間以及所需位置的所有可能操作。我發現這大大提高了我的生產率。
這是這種心態的其他一些體現:
數據庫對象超鏈接
使用Ctrl鍵,可以向下鉆取原始源代碼,在該源代碼中聲明類型,變量,表/視圖或函數/過程。閱讀手冊以充分理解這一點;您將立即了解使用數據庫瀏覽器進行所有導航可以節省多少時間。
SQL語句識別
另一個示例是右鍵單擊任何SQL語句中的任意位置,以將其發送到“查詢生成器”或“解釋計劃”窗口。同樣,其他工具會限制您進入“解釋”窗口的位置,但在PSD中,它可能會在出現SQL語句的任何位置發生。
代碼助手
現在,大多數工具都具有稱為“代碼助手”或“代碼洞察”的功能。PSD可以在您可以鍵入的任何地方提供此功能,而不僅僅是在其他工具規定的編輯器窗口中。
代碼內容
經過所有這些跳動和鉆研,“代碼目錄”面板可以像瀏覽器一樣記住您去過的地方,使您可以前進或后退,或跳到存儲程序中的任何位置。
瀏覽器
PSD中的數據庫瀏覽器是相當標準的。頂層的普通香草文件夾有些丑陋,但頂層以下的所有內容都使用對象特定的圖標。與該工具的其余部分一樣,瀏覽器是高度可配置的。可以對文件夾進行顏色編碼,根據需要排序,從視圖中刪除文件夾,以及使用可以針對USER_OBJECTS進行編碼的任何謂詞對文件夾進行過濾。您甚至可以創建自己的文件夾和其中的對象層次結構。
不幸的是,瀏覽器不是可停靠的,因此當它可見并展開時,它需要編輯窗口所需的大部分屏幕空間。希望此問題將在下一次更新中得到解決。
客制化
如前所述,如果出現問題,您可以根據自己的喜好自定義此工具。為此,“首選項”窗口中有31個選項卡。您以前使用過的以前使用過的任何快捷鍵都可以映射到您喜歡的位置。它甚至可以自定義主菜單的各個部分,添加喜歡的宏和指向文檔的鏈接。最后一點對于任何團隊開發都是有用的。您可以將每個開發人員的安裝指向偏好,宏,模板,項目范圍的培訓以及過程或標準文檔的集中存儲庫。自97年以來,我就一直希望在PL / SQL IDE中使用此功能,但是直到現在為止,從未見過任何正確的功能。
數據庫瀏覽器也是可定制的。可以應用各種默認或自定義過濾器,這在具有成百上千個Oracle對象的環境中很有用。此外,瀏覽器還會跟蹤您最近使用過的物品,從而使您的生活更加輕松。出于某種奇怪的原因,經過5年的等待,我仍然無法自定義瀏覽器頂層用于每個文件夾的圖標,但否則我對瀏覽器感到滿意。
最后,Allround和獨立的PSD愛好者創建了25個插件來擴展PSD。在我看來,最有用的功能是那些使用您自己喜歡的查詢和命令擴展瀏覽器的功能,plsqldoc(可從PL / SQL代碼生成HTML文檔),用于ERD圖的Quick ER,版本控制界面和FTP界面。如果找不到所需的內容,則可以使用任何可以創建DLL的工具來構建自己的插件。
本站文章除注明轉載外,均為本站原創或翻譯。歡迎任何形式的轉載,但請務必注明出處、不得修改原文相關鏈接,如果存在內容上的異議請郵件反饋至chenjj@fc6vip.cn
文章轉載自: